Product Overview

The cellularline Ozone headset offers a unique open-ear design, utilizing Air Conduction technology to provide audio while maintaining awareness of your surroundings. This true wireless headset is designed for comfort and safety, allowing you to listen to music and make calls without fully isolating yourself. Its adjustable ear cups ensure a precise fit and optimal sound delivery, and with IPX5 certification, it is resistant to sweat and splashes, making it suitable for various activities.

Charging the Headset

  1. Place the Ozone headset into its charging case, ensuring proper alignment with the charging contacts.
  2. Connect the charging cable to the charging case and a compatible USB power source.
  3. The indicator lights on the case and/or headset will show charging status. A full charge takes approximately 1.5 hours.
  4. Once fully charged, the headset provides up to 9 hours of playtime on a single charge, with the charging case extending total playtime to 54 hours.

Pairing with a Device

  1. Ensure the headset is charged.
  2. Open the charging case. The headset will automatically enter pairing mode, indicated by a flashing LED light.
  3. On your mobile phone or compatible device, go to Bluetooth settings.
  4. Search for available devices and select "Ozone" from the list.
  5. Once connected, the LED indicator on the headset will stop flashing and remain solid, or turn off, depending on the model.

Water Resistance (IPX5)

The Ozone headset is IPX5 certified, meaning it is protected against low-pressure water jets from any direction. This makes it resistant to sweat and light splashes, but it is not designed for submersion in water. Do not rinse under running water or use while swimming.

Troubleshooting

ProblemPossible CauseSolution
Headset does not power on.Low battery.Place the headset in the charging case and charge fully.
Cannot pair with device.Bluetooth is off on device; Headset not in pairing mode; Device too far.Ensure Bluetooth is enabled on your device. Open the charging case to put headset in pairing mode. Move device closer to headset.
No sound or low volume.Volume too low on device/headset; Headset not properly positioned; Not connected.Increase volume on both headset and connected device. Adjust ear cup for proper sound direction. Reconnect the headset to your device.
Intermittent connection.Interference; Device too far; Low battery.Move away from sources of strong electromagnetic interference. Keep device within Bluetooth range. Charge the headset.

Product Specifications

FeatureDetail
Model NameBTOZONETWSK
Connectivity TechnologyWireless, Bluetooth
Form FactorOpen-ear
IP RatingIPX5 (Sweat and Splash Proof)
Total PlaytimeUp to 54 hours (with charging case)
Single Charge PlaytimeUp to 9 hours
Charging TimeApprox. 1.5 hours
Compatible DevicesMobile phones
Control TypeCall Control
Item Weight100 grams (0.1 Kilograms)
Product Dimensions12.1 x 16.5 x 4 cm
Batteries3 Lithium Ion batteries (included)
MaterialPlastic
ColorBlack
